Effect

The audience sees a deck of Lego-themed playing cards. The magician performs a card routine, often involving a signed card. At the climax, the entire deck visually transforms into a solid block of Lego bricks in the spectator's hands. The block is examinable, and the transformation is angle-proof.

Full Details

Bricked by Drew Perry is a modern take on classic effects like the Omni Deck and Solid Deception. It includes:

  • A custom Lego-themed deck with court cards designed as Lego characters.
  • A solid Lego block gimmick that matches the deck's back design.
  • Multiple gaff cards for additional routines (e.g., Chicago Opener, Runaway Joker).
  • A 3-hour tutorial with routines taught by Drew Perry and Craig Petty, covering beginner to advanced handlings.
  • Options for signed card routines, with refill decks available.

The trick is designed to be versatile, working for strolling, table magic, and stage performances. The Lego theme adds a playful, relatable hook for audiences.

Difficulty

  • Basic handling: Easy to learn, with the core method teachable in 15-20 minutes.
  • Advanced routines: Require practice (e.g., deck switches, tilt moves).
  • Angle management: The trick is angle-proof, but some handlings need careful timing.
